Nutrition Target Calculator

The Nutrition Target Calculator is a practical diet-planning tool that estimates your daily calorie needs and converts them into personalized protein, carbohydrate, and fat targets. Whether your goal is fat loss, weight maintenance, or lean muscle gain, this calculator starts with the Mifflin-St Jeor equation to estimate resting energy expenditure, then applies your activity level and a safe weekly rate of change.

After calculating your daily calorie target, the tool breaks it into grams of protein, carbs, and fat using the macro split you select. You can choose a balanced split, a higher-protein split, or a lower-carbohydrate split to match your training style and food preferences. The full calculation breakdown shows each step, so you always know where your numbers come from.

This tool is designed for anyone planning meals, tracking calories, or setting nutrition goals — from first-time dieters to experienced lifters and busy coaches. Treat the result as an educated starting point, not a medical prescription.

Step-by-Step Guide

Start by entering your sex, age, height, and weight in the Your Details section. Height can be entered in centimeters or inches, and weight in kilograms or pounds; the calculator converts everything to metric units before running the formulas. Next, select your activity level from the dropdown menu. This factor adjusts your basal metabolic rate (BMR) to account for the energy you burn through daily movement and structured exercise, so it is worth choosing honestly — an office worker who trains twice a week is usually closer to Light than to Moderate.

Then set your goal and your weekly rate of change. A rate of –0.5 kg/week creates a moderate calorie deficit suited to fat loss, while +0.25 kg/week supports a slow, lean muscle gain with minimal fat accumulation. Choose 0 to hold your weight steady. Finally, pick a macro split that fits your training style and food preferences, press Calculate Targets, and review the breakdown.

If you are unsure which activity level to pick, choose the one that describes your typical week, not your best week. Most people who work at a desk and exercise 1–3 times per week fall into the Light category.

How It Works

The calorie target is built in three steps. First, the Mifflin-St Jeor equation estimates your BMR — the energy your body consumes at complete rest. For men: BMR = 10 × weight (kg) + 6.25 × height (cm) − 5 × age + 5. For women: BMR = 10 × weight (kg) + 6.25 × height (cm) − 5 × age − 161.

Second, your BMR is multiplied by an activity factor between 1.2 and 1.9 to estimate your Total Daily Energy Expenditure (TDEE). Third, the calculator applies your weekly rate of change. Because roughly 7700 kcal equals about 1 kg of body fat, the tool converts your selected pace into a daily calorie adjustment: losing 0.5 kg/week means a deficit of about 550 kcal per day, and gaining 0.5 kg/week means the same surplus. Macro grams are then derived from your selected split using the standard energy densities: protein and carbohydrates provide 4 kcal per gram, while fat provides 9 kcal per gram. Worked Example

Example: A 30-year-old woman, 165 cm tall, weighing 60 kg, moderately active (factor 1.55), wants to lose about 0.25 kg per week with a balanced split.

BMR = 10 × 60 + 6.25 × 165 − 5 × 30 − 161 = 1320 kcal/day.
TDEE = 1320 × 1.55 ≈ 2046 kcal/day.
Deficit = 0.25 × 7700 ÷ 7 ≈ 275 kcal/day.
Calorie target ≈ 1771 kcal/day.

Using the 30/40/30 split, the macro targets would be approximately: protein 133 g, carbs 177 g, and fat 59 g. If the same person instead chose to gain 0.25 kg/week, the calculator would add about 275 kcal per day instead of subtracting it.

Reference: Macro Split Options

Each split changes how your daily calories are distributed. The table below summarizes what each option emphasizes and who typically benefits most from it.

SplitProteinCarbsFatBest for
Balanced 30/40/3030%40%30%General health, moderate training, most people
Higher Protein 35/35/3035%35%30%Strength training, appetite control, higher protein needs
Lower Carb 30/25/4530%25%45%Low-carb preference, fat adaptation, insulin sensitivity focus

Common Mistakes to Avoid

One common error is mixing up units — typing your weight as if it were kilograms when you actually weigh it in pounds, or reading a result in pounds and assuming it is kilograms. Double-check the unit dropdowns before calculating. A second mistake is choosing an aggressive deficit. Even a moderately larger deficit than 0.5 kg/week can reduce energy, disrupt sleep, and increase muscle loss, so the tool deliberately keeps rates within a sustainable range.

Another mistake is treating protein as a percentage rather than a gram target. During weight loss, eating protein in grams based on body weight — often 1.6 to 2.2 g per kg — matters more than hitting a perfect percentage, because protein helps preserve lean mass. Finally, do not treat the output as a fixed prescription. Calories and hormones fluctuate day to day; the target is a starting point to test over 2–3 weeks and adjust based on real-world results.

Frequently Asked Questions

Should I recalculate after I lose weight? Yes. As your weight drops, your BMR decreases because smaller bodies burn fewer calories. Recalculate every 5 kg of weight change, or every 4–6 weeks, to keep your targets accurate.

What is the difference between BMR and TDEE? BMR is the energy your body needs at complete rest to keep organs functioning. TDEE adds the energy used for daily movement, digestion, and exercise. Your eating target is based on TDEE, not BMR.

Is this calorie target safe? The built-in rates of change limit you to a sensible deficit or surplus, but individual needs vary with medical conditions, medications, and body composition. If you have a health condition, are pregnant or nursing, or have a history of an eating disorder, consult a doctor or registered dietitian before changing your diet.
